A Case Study on Teaching and Learning Writing Recount Text on Merdeka Curriculum at The Tenth Grade of The Students of TKJ 2 SMKN 1 Bantul in The Academic Year 2023/2024

Writing is vital in English education, particularly for vocational school students who need practical communication abilities. This study explores the teaching and learning of recount text writing under the Merdeka Curriculum at SMKN 1 Bantul, where recount texts are used to enhance students’ narrative and linguistic skills. The research aims to investigate instructional strategies, student engagement, and curriculum implementation challenges in recount writing lessons. Using a qualitative case study design, data were collected through classroom observations, teacher and student interviews, and document analysis of lesson plans and syllabi. The findings reveal that the teacher employed structured guidance, multimedia resources, and collaborative tasks to facilitate learning. Although students participated actively, many struggled with grammar and vocabulary, which affected their writing proficiency. Instructional media like PowerPoint and videos enhanced understanding, yet individualized feedback and differentiated instruction were limited. Assessment relied primarily on group tasks and observation, lacking personalized evaluation mechanisms. These results suggest that while current strategies align with Merdeka Curriculum principles, improvements are needed in language support, feedback systems, and assessment frameworks. The study implies that integrating interactive, student-centered approaches with targeted grammar instruction and more individualized assessment can enhance the effectiveness of writing instruction in vocational settings. Future research is recommended to compare practices across schools to identify broader trends and best practices in implementing writing pedagogy under the Merdeka Curriculum.
